Women On The Dark Side began as a very popular panel at pop culture conventions including San Diego Comic-Con International, WonderCon, Long Beach Comic Con, Silicon Valley Comic con and many others. This year, we've decided to expand the brand into featuring female filmmakers (and those who identify as female) who create on the darker side.


This first year of the Women On The Dark Side Film Festival is being managed by First Glance Films.


Women are often discouraged from expressing their darker side. We think you should embrace it. Dark doesn't mean just horror. Thrillers, dramas and even comedies can be as dark as horror, if done right.


The festival is open to short films (under 30 minutes) and stand-alone episodes of web series (12 minutes or under), both live action and animated.


Entries must have a significant amount of women in above-the-line positions - producer, director, writer, cinematographer, lead actors, etc.


We encourage you to think outside of the usual tropes of women in darker-themed films and see if you can break those tropes.


The festival will be held at Los Angeles Comic Con in October, 2019.


Entrants who are selected will receive passes for the convention and will be featured on a panel during the convention. All Official Selections may receive a complimentary pass to LA Comic Con. Participants are responsible for their travel expenses to Los Angeles.


Films will be judged by industry professionals.


A prize package worth over $500 will be awarded to the best film in the festival. The package will include prizes by our sponsors: Final Draft, Fanbase Press, Handsome Hobo Neckwear, Kymera Press, Bubbles & Things Soaps, Geeky Teas & Games, among others.
